Rupert Otis "Ruchie" Jones Jr., 70, of 180 Joneslan Trail, died Sunday, Sept. 20, 2009, at his home.

Memorial services will be conducted at 2 p.m. today, Sept. 23, 2009, at Mizpah United Methodist Church, where he was a member, with the Rev. Tom Goode, the Rev. Roy Ward and David Langston officiating.

A lifelong resident of Rockingham County, he was a son of Rupert O. Jones Sr. and the late Frances Wagoner Jones. Ruchie was an elected official with the Rockingham Co. Soil and Water Conservation Service and retired after 35 years of service. He was a farmer and a partner in Jones Produce, a charter member and former chairman of the Board of Directors of the Monroeton Vol. Fire Dept., and had served on the cemetery committee and on many boards and committees at Mizpah United Meth. Church. Ruchie was selected in 1970 as a Rockingham Co. Outstanding Young Farmer, and was a veteran of the U.S. Army and the National Guard.
